Definitions:

Interbreeding Populations

Groups of the same species that are capable of reproducing together, sharing a common gene pool.

Reproductive Isolation

A collection of mechanisms, behaviors, and physiological processes that prevent the members of two different species from producing offspring, or ensure that any offspring are sterile.

Speciation

Emergence of a new species.
